Output ebc20e335a7ea24ad816a507513b91bcfe4cdf24d305d388f16c5a8819fe14ad:3

value
11531365
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 eb6470434c316ec29ab1f536449b68d6ae83dd04 OP_EQUALVERIFY OP_CHECKSIG
address
1NTe7fwPLAQimiJ2JHh51m9EM6XUZ6PKBn
transaction
ebc20e335a7ea24ad816a507513b91bcfe4cdf24d305d388f16c5a8819fe14ad
spent
true